Olivia Rutazibwa

Olivia Rutazibwa is a doctor in Political Sciences and lecturer in International Development and European Studies at the University of Portsmouth. A Belgian national from Antwerp, Olivia is the former Africa desk editor for MO* Magazine for which she continues to write monthly op-eds.

Twitter :

Articles by this author (1)